DAMAGE to children's play equipment at Stourport War Memorial Park has been described as a "real shame" by the town's mayor.
The wooden Marco Polo equipment suffered damage to its roof, with panels snapped off, at the weekend and is now closed until repairs can be carried out.
Mayor of Stourport David Little said: "The £7,000 for this play equipment was donated to us by the Friends of Stourport Memorial Park, which has since wound up, so it's a real shame it has fallen victim to mindless vandalism.
"Luckily our park keeper has visited the site and thinks we can repair it in house.
"We have a contingency fund for this sort of thing but it is just annoying when we have been given this money to provide new facilities for local kids.
"We hope the equipment can be repaired by the end of the week."
